When specifying door handles it can be helpful to know some common terminology:
Internal passage door - an internal hinged door that does not lock.
Internal privacy door - an internal hinged door that is locked with a thumb turn & emergency release.
External door - a door to the outside that is locked with a key.
Latch - the mechanism that holds the door closed.
Mortice latch - a latch installed in a rectangular hole in the door edge.
Lock - a lockable latch.

Door lever handles are considered more ergonomically friendly than door knobs. The design of door lever handles allows for a more natural and comfortable hand position while operating the door. They require a simple downward motion, which is easier on the wrist and hand muscles compared to the twisting or gripping motion required by door knobs. This makes door lever handles easier to use for children, the elderly, and people with limited strengh or mobility.
